Dear colleagues
Please find attached notification of a research event focusing on the
development of forensic science research to be held on 5th December 2013
at the Royal Society of Edinburgh. The event is aimed at early career
academics/researchers from any discipline.
This is the first time such as meeting has been held in Scotland and as
such we wish to bring it to the attention of as many colleagues as
possible. The aim is to bring together colleagues from a wide range of
disciplines to collectively address the research challenges within the
domain. The event has been organised by Professor Niamh Nic Daeid,
University of Strathclyde and Professor Sue Black, University of Dundee
and is sponsored and supported by the Technology Strategy Board,
Scottish Enterprise and the Forensic Science special interest group.
